The aggression against press professionals during the Summit of the Americas, held in May in Brasilia, became yet another argument in the PF (Federal Police) in favor of maintaining presidential security under its responsibility.
By law, the security of foreign delegations is the responsibility of the PF, which is in charge of all stages, including escort, area sweeps and displacements.
Of the nine delegations present at the meeting, the only one that had any complications was that of the Venezuelan dictator, Nicolás Maduro, who had the participation of the GSI.
As Maduro left the Itamaraty Palace and answered questions from the press, at least three journalists reported attacks. Reporter Delis Ortiz, from TV Globo, claimed to have received a punch in the chest. Reporter Sergio Roxo, from O Globo, was dragged by his clothes and then immobilized; and a third professional, Sofia Aguiar, from Agência Estado, said she was pushed by a security guard. The GSI instituted an investigation.
The PF has been responsible for the immediate security of the president since the beginning of the government of Luiz Inácio Lula da Silva (PT) and has been investing in the training and qualification of personnel. The corporation intends to maintain the attribution, initially scheduled to end on June 30.
The GSI (Institutional Security Office), however, which was responsible for the attribution before, sees it as natural to resume the task with the end of the validity of the decree.
In an interview with Sheet, Minister Marco Antônio Amaro stated that the return of the role to the GSI was “practically decided”.
